[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]OP, geez. My DS12 has ADHD--(he's the opposite, so anxious over rejection, I can't get him to text anyone once). You need to call the child's parents-- this isn't really a school matter- it's an area where the parents need to intervene. The other child has impulse control issues or possibly anxiety. His parents need to be involved to help him manage these impulses and feelings. You can do it in a way that's kind and neutral--simply say, "hey, friends move on, but Larlo seems to be having difficulty with it. I'm a parent too, and I would want to know if this was happenening." I would want to be called--if you don't want to do it, it's time to involve school counselor for both kids' sakes. [/quote] ...and no, this is not stalking, but it's a situation that's going escalate with your DS getting fed up, or the other child becoming increasingly anxious and upset when he doesn't hear back from your son. It's time for adults to intervene--past time imo. Your child should not have to self advocate in this situation, and it's possible that this other child needs help with social skills (at the least) but possibly impulse control/anxiety. As for twelve year old boys, I have a twelve year old boy. *Many* engage in outright inappropriate behavior from time to time--they need guidance from adults. Their judgement and emotional regulation at this age...so, underdeveloped... it's a wonder our species survives. [/quote]
